New & Pre-Construction FAQs

Pre-construction is purchased before or during construction, while new construction is already completed or nearly complete.

Yes. The developer has their own sales team representing their interests. Having your own agent ensures someone is looking out for you.

Sometimes. If pricing isnโ€™t flexible, developers may offer incentives such as closing cost credits, upgrades, or deposit incentives.

Deposit schedules vary by developer but are often spread over several construction milestones and typically total 20-50% before closing.

Yes. Most buyers obtain financing at completion, although some developers require mortgage pre-approval during the contract process.

Most projects take anywhere from 18 to 48 months, depending on the size and complexity of the development.

Yes. Construction delays due to weather, permitting, labor shortages, or supply chain issues are common.

Your contract price remains the same regardless of market fluctuations, whether values rise or fall.

Some developments allow contract assignments, while others prohibit them or charge an assignment fee.

Depending on the construction stage, buyers may have options for flooring, cabinetry, countertops, appliances, and other finishes.

Initial estimates are provided, but association fees may change once the community is operating.

Most developers provide warranties covering workmanship, systems, and structural components for specified periods.

Yes. Buyers should always conduct an independent inspection before closing, even on brand-new homes.

Closing costs may include title insurance, lender fees, recording fees, prepaid taxes, HOA contributions, and developer fees.

Usually yes, although some developers offer incentives if you use their preferred lender.

Pre-construction contracts are generally binding, and canceling may result in losing part or all of your deposit.

Yes. Many developers welcome international buyers, although financing options may differ.

Ownership transfers at closing when all required documents are signed and funds are received.

Early buyers often enjoy the best pricing and selection, while later buyers have greater certainty about the finished product.

Potential appreciation during construction, brand-new finishes and appliances, modern building standards, lower maintenance costs, warranty protection, and the opportunity to personalize certain features.
